A nurse is caring for a patient who needs constant care in the home setting and for whom most of the care is provided by the patient's family. Which action should the nurse take to help relieve stress?

A) Encourage caregiver to do as much as possible.
B) Focus primarily on the patient.
C) Point out weaknesses.
D) Provide education.
